Browse Source

css test for tablefield

ouidade 1 year ago
parent
commit
8df9fc6ecc

+ 1 - 0
config/sync/editor.editor.wysiwyg.yml

@@ -46,6 +46,7 @@ settings:
           name: Outils
           items:
             - Source
+            - Table
         -
           name: Copy/Paste
           items:

+ 0 - 1
config/sync/language/en/system.site.yml

@@ -1 +0,0 @@
-name: materiO’

+ 1 - 1
config/sync/system.site.yml

@@ -2,7 +2,7 @@ _core:
   default_config_hash: KpKfgMpPrABs7m0Uqd8VFuYXns2cRXsuYy0QL4SRE14
 langcode: fr
 uuid: eb24bc99-64ef-496d-beb3-b02a8573f75f
-name: Blbblkmkjfpa
+name: 'International Rorschach Institute'
 mail: dev@figureslibres.io
 slogan: ''
 page:

+ 0 - 31
config/sync/user.role.user.yml

@@ -3,23 +3,13 @@ langcode: fr
 status: true
 dependencies:
   config:
-    - filter.format.wysiwyg
     - node.type.book
   module:
-    - block_content
     - book
     - book_access_code
-    - config_pages
-    - contact
     - content_translation
-    - field_ui
-    - filter
-    - menu_admin_per_menu
     - node
-    - paragraphs
-    - profile
     - tablefield
-    - taxonomy
 _core:
   default_config_hash: i1HX2g6ycNxMoSaVKRrMZtmApin-bVKG1d0FG04peQw
 id: user
@@ -27,30 +17,11 @@ label: Editor
 weight: -4
 is_admin: null
 permissions:
-  - 'access content overview'
   - 'access printer-friendly version'
   - 'add access codes'
   - 'add content to books'
   - 'addrow tablefield'
-  - 'administer block_content display'
-  - 'administer block_content form display'
   - 'administer book outlines'
-  - 'administer config_pages display'
-  - 'administer config_pages form display'
-  - 'administer contact_message display'
-  - 'administer contact_message form display'
-  - 'administer display modes'
-  - 'administer main menu items'
-  - 'administer node display'
-  - 'administer node form display'
-  - 'administer paragraph display'
-  - 'administer paragraph form display'
-  - 'administer profile display'
-  - 'administer profile form display'
-  - 'administer taxonomy_term display'
-  - 'administer taxonomy_term form display'
-  - 'administer user display'
-  - 'administer user form display'
   - 'create book content'
   - 'create content translations'
   - 'create defalut workflow_transition'
@@ -69,7 +40,5 @@ permissions:
   - 'rebuild tablefield'
   - 'translate book node'
   - 'translate editable entities'
-  - 'translate paragraph'
   - 'update content translations'
-  - 'use text format wysiwyg'
   - 'view own unpublished content'

+ 19 - 36
web/themes/custom/rorschach/css-compiled/styles.css

@@ -18,6 +18,20 @@ table {
     text-align: center;
     padding: 1rem; }
 
+#paragraph-id--226 td {
+  text-align: start;
+  padding: 0rem;
+  padding-left: 1rem;
+  padding-right: 1rem; }
+
+#paragraph-id--226 tbody {
+  border-collapse: collapse; }
+  #paragraph-id--226 tbody tr {
+    border-collapse: collapse; }
+
+#paragraph-id--227 td {
+  text-align: start; }
+
 /*global*/
 @font-face {
   font-family: 'Font Awesome';
@@ -813,38 +827,6 @@ article.node-type-book {
     list-style: none;
     box-shadow: 0px 0px 1px black; }
 
-#edit-field-article-0-subform-field-subheading-0-format {
-  font-size: 1rem;
-  visibility: hidden; }
-
-#edit-field-article-1-subform-field-subheading-0-format {
-  font-size: 1rem;
-  visibility: hidden; }
-
-#edit-field-article-2-subform-field-subheading-0-format {
-  font-size: 1rem;
-  visibility: hidden; }
-
-#edit-field-article-3-subform-field-subheading-0-format {
-  font-size: 1rem;
-  visibility: hidden; }
-
-#edit-field-article-4-subform-field-subheading-0-format {
-  font-size: 1rem;
-  visibility: hidden; }
-
-#edit-field-article-5-subform-field-subheading-0-format {
-  font-size: 1rem;
-  visibility: hidden; }
-
-#edit-field-article-6-subform-field-subheading-0-format {
-  font-size: 1rem;
-  visibility: hidden; }
-
-#edit-field-article-8-subform-field-subheading-0-format {
-  font-size: 1rem;
-  visibility: hidden; }
-
 /*partials*/
 .layout-container {
   position: relative;
@@ -1013,9 +995,10 @@ article.node-type-book {
   list-style: none;
   display: flex;
   flex-direction: row;
-  justify-content: flex-start; }
+  justify-content: flex-start;
+  flex-wrap: wrap; }
   #block-breadcrumbs nav ol li {
-    padding-right: 1rem; }
+    padding-right: 0.5rem; }
     #block-breadcrumbs nav ol li ::after {
-      padding-left: 1rem;
-      content: " >"; }
+      padding-left: 0.5rem;
+      content: ">>"; }

+ 23 - 0
web/themes/custom/rorschach/scss/components/_tablefields.scss

@@ -24,4 +24,27 @@ table{
 }
 
 
+#paragraph-id--226{
+    td{
+        text-align: start;
+        padding: 0rem;
+        padding-left: 1rem;
+        padding-right: 1rem;
+
+    }
+    tbody {
+        border-collapse:collapse;   
+        tr{
+            border-collapse:collapse;   
+        }
+    }
+}
+
+
+// tableau créer avec wysiwyg
+#paragraph-id--227{
+    td{
+        text-align: start;
+    }
+}
 

+ 32 - 32
web/themes/custom/rorschach/scss/pages/_editform.scss

@@ -1,39 +1,39 @@
 
 
 
-#edit-field-article-0-subform-field-subheading-0-format{
-    font-size: 1rem;
-    visibility: hidden;
-}
+// #edit-field-article-0-subform-field-subheading-0-format{
+//     font-size: 1rem;
+//     visibility: hidden;
+// }
 
-#edit-field-article-1-subform-field-subheading-0-format{
-    font-size: 1rem;
-    visibility: hidden;
-}
+// #edit-field-article-1-subform-field-subheading-0-format{
+//     font-size: 1rem;
+//     visibility: hidden;
+// }
 
-#edit-field-article-2-subform-field-subheading-0-format{
-    font-size: 1rem;
-    visibility: hidden;
-}
+// #edit-field-article-2-subform-field-subheading-0-format{
+//     font-size: 1rem;
+//     visibility: hidden;
+// }
 
-#edit-field-article-3-subform-field-subheading-0-format{
-    font-size: 1rem;
-    visibility: hidden;
-}
-#edit-field-article-4-subform-field-subheading-0-format{
-    font-size: 1rem;
-    visibility: hidden;
-}
+// #edit-field-article-3-subform-field-subheading-0-format{
+//     font-size: 1rem;
+//     visibility: hidden;
+// }
+// #edit-field-article-4-subform-field-subheading-0-format{
+//     font-size: 1rem;
+//     visibility: hidden;
+// }
 
-#edit-field-article-5-subform-field-subheading-0-format{
-    font-size: 1rem;
-    visibility: hidden;
-}
-#edit-field-article-6-subform-field-subheading-0-format{
-    font-size: 1rem;
-    visibility: hidden;
-}
-#edit-field-article-8-subform-field-subheading-0-format{
-    font-size: 1rem;
-    visibility: hidden;
-}
+// #edit-field-article-5-subform-field-subheading-0-format{
+//     font-size: 1rem;
+//     visibility: hidden;
+// }
+// #edit-field-article-6-subform-field-subheading-0-format{
+//     font-size: 1rem;
+//     visibility: hidden;
+// }
+// #edit-field-article-8-subform-field-subheading-0-format{
+//     font-size: 1rem;
+//     visibility: hidden;
+// }

+ 4 - 3
web/themes/custom/rorschach/scss/partials/_breadcrumbs.scss

@@ -5,12 +5,13 @@
             display: flex;
             flex-direction: row;
             justify-content: flex-start;
+            flex-wrap: wrap;
 
             li{
-                padding-right: 1rem;
+                padding-right: 0.5rem;
                 ::after{
-                    padding-left: 1rem;
-                    content: " >";
+                    padding-left: 0.5rem;
+                    content: ">>";
                 }
             }
 

+ 15 - 0
web/themes/custom/rorschach/templates/partials/image.html.twig

@@ -0,0 +1,15 @@
+{#
+/**
+ * @file
+ * Default theme implementation of an image.
+ *
+ * Available variables:
+ * - attributes: HTML attributes for the img tag.
+ * - style_name: (optional) The name of the image style applied.
+ *
+ * @see template_preprocess_image()
+ *
+ * @ingroup themeable
+ */
+#}
+<img{{ attributes }} />